Day III: Ponce
7:00-8:30am. Breakfast and "check-out".
8:30am. We leave for Ponce.
10:30am. Arrival at the city of Ponce, the second
most important city in P.R. Trolley tour through the
city. Upon returning to plaza las Delicias we will
visit the Cathedral and the Firemen's Museum.
1:30pm.
Lunch (included).
3:00pm. Visit to the La Guancha Boardwalk.
4:00pm. We leave for the parador. Arrival and "check-in".
Free night: we suggest a tour of 'La Parguera'
Dinner (included).
Day
IV: Dry Forest and Beach
7:00-8:00am. Breakfast (included).
8:30am. We leave for the Dry Forest in Guánica.
The most studied biosphere reserve in the world.
12:30pm. Lunch (included).
1:30pm. We leave for Caña Gorda Beach. Enjoy
a bath in the warm waters of the Caribbean Sea.
4:30pm. Return to the parador.
Dinner (incluided).

Day
VI: Camuy Caves and Observatory
7:00-8:00am. Breakfast (included).
8:30am. We leave for the Camuy Caves, catalogued
by experts as the third most importan underground
cave system in the world. The tour through the caverns
takes approximately two hours, but our visit will
last for four hours.
1:30 or 2:00pm. Lunch. After lunch, if we have time,
we will visit the Arecibo Observatory, the largest
in the world.
4:30pm. We leave for San Juan. Upon arrival, we check
into the hotel.
Gala dinner (included).

General
recommendations:
* Plan your flights so that you arrive in Puerto Rico
before 3:00 pm (15:00) and your departure more or
less at the same hour.
* Always have sunblock handy.
* Umbrellas and raincoats.
* Swimsuit (if you're going to swim).
* Pack lightly, no more than two pieces of luggage.
* Pack casual and sporty clothing only. (Our average
temperature is 84°F or 28°C.)
* Comfortable shoes.
* Change your currency into dollars (U.S.A). Our official
currency is the United States dollar.
